Soul Train Awards Return After 2-year Hiatus

The Soul Train Awards plan to return to the air after a two-year hiatus to recognize those who helped shape R&B music.
Record executive Antonio “L.A.” Reid, singers Kenny “Babyface” Edmonds, Chaka Khan and Charlie Wilson will be honored on the two-hour music special to be taped in Atlanta.

Herbie Hancock New LA Phil Jazz Creative Chair

Herbie Hancock has grand plans for his new position as the Los Angeles Philharmonic’s creative chair for jazz.

In Time of Need, Chaka Khan Steps In For Natalie Cole

Legendary singer Chaka Khan just stepped in to help recovering soulful singer Natalie Cole, this after Cole’s kidney transplant and loss of a family member.
Khan, known widely for singles like “I’m Every Woman” and “Tell Me Something Good,” will take Cole’s place at the 17th Annual Capital Jazz Fest.

Etta James Hospitalized

Medical problems cause legendary singer to miss tour.

Legendary Blues singer Etta James is reported to be in stable condition in a Los Angeles hospital suffering from complications following abdominal surgery.
